Wortman Outlines Rockingham Plan

Published: January 28, 2010 10:43 pm EST

Rockingham Park could join the list of racetracks offering slots-fueled purses if legislation is passed to expand gambling in Salem, New Hampshire

.

According to Fosters.com, Bill Wortman - a Millennium Gaming executive - has put forth a proposal for a casino holding 5,000 slot machines.

Wortman, who started his own gaming company in the 80s, projects the casino could generate up to 1,700 jobs during construction and about 1,000 jobs upon completion. He also said the project could attract five million visitations and bring in revenues of $400 million – a number that would help the state’s budget.

"It's a dynamic project," said Wortman. "Its not going to fix the entire budget problem, it's a very, very good opportunity in the state of New Hampshire for what we do and for the state."
